Are Entertainers More Valuable than Teachers?

I bumped into my old high school teacher earlier today and was disheartened by the news that like most public school employees, she is having a difficult time making ends meet in these hard times.

Then I remembered reading about Wowowee emcee Willie Revillame making at least P700,000 per day - that's per day. That's an insane amount by any standards - even American standards. With her salary now, my former teacher will have to work at least 20 years just to come close to what the guy earns in a day.

I don't have anything personal against Mr. Revillame. For all I know, he deserves the whole amount from ABS-CBN's financial perspective. But when public school teachers are paid such lowly wages and entertainers compensated so dearly, something must be terribly wrong with our society. After all, public school teachers are the ones responsible for shaping our youth, and therefore our country's future. There is something to said about our country's priority if they are paid such lowly wages, and therefore, deemed dispensable.
